Hidden Risks and Misleading Norms in Slot Advertising
Despite growing awareness, common pitfalls persist in slot advertising. Exaggerated return claims—often framed as “guaranteed wins”—fuel unrealistic expectations. Low-probability messaging subtly triggers impulsive decisions, while psychological triggers like variable rewards reinforce compulsive patterns. These tactics create a gap between promotional language and actual player outcomes, a disconnect transparency aims to close.
For instance, many ads highlight “big wins” without clarifying that such outcomes occur in less than 1% of spins. Without explicit disclaimers, users may underestimate the odds, leading to prolonged play and heightened risk. Transparent advertising counters this by anchoring claims in statistical reality—turning persuasive intent into informed choice.

Practical Strategies for Building Transparent Gambling Advertising
Creating transparent gambling ads requires intentional design. First, integrate clear terms and conditions directly into visuals, avoiding dense legal jargon. Second, embed realistic performance disclaimers—such as “average player loses X% over time”—to ground expectations. Third, use educational content to promote informed decision-making, turning awareness into empowerment.
These strategies reflect a broader trend: transparency as a competitive advantage. Platforms that prioritize honesty do not just comply—they build lasting trust with users navigating high-risk choices.
